Output 0583914a22c329b290175c900f0014c99ddb854897ae6caac3ffba87f43e04eb:84

value
22237167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51c9d19279b7d893939d389b393f0df5ea88467 OP_EQUAL
address
3JCeWNqhoiQXt8cvgLHVk32YEvMhYjA7jU
transaction
0583914a22c329b290175c900f0014c99ddb854897ae6caac3ffba87f43e04eb
confirmations
349025
spent
true